Consumer Loan Agreement
Produces an execution-ready consumer loan agreement with a Reg Z–compliant federal disclosure box and full contractual provisions for fixed-rate consumer credit.
Quick Start
Collect before drafting:
- Lender — legal name (including DBA), address, contact info
- Borrower(s) — full legal name(s), addresses; co-borrower/guarantor if any
- Loan economics — principal, interest rate, term, payment frequency, first payment date
- Fee schedule — all charges imposed as condition of credit (origination, points, doc prep, service charges)
- Collateral — description with identifiers (VIN/serial/legal description) if secured; confirm if unsecured
- Governing state — for usury caps, prepayment penalty rules, cure periods, deficiency judgment limits
- Co-signer/guarantor — triggers FTC co-signer notice (16 CFR Part 444)
Output Structure
1. Federal Truth in Lending Disclosure Box
Place first on page one. Visually segregated (border/shading), heading bold ≥12pt, body ≥10pt. Use Reg Z–prescribed labels verbatim — never paraphrase.
| Reg Z Label | Requirements |
|---|
| Annual Percentage Rate — The cost of your credit as a yearly rate | ≥2 decimal places; actuarial or U.S. Rule method; tolerance ±⅛% regular, ±¼% irregular (12 CFR § 1026.22) |
| Finance Charge — The dollar amount the credit will cost you | Total interest + all fees as condition of credit; itemize major components |
| Amount Financed — The amount of credit provided to you or on your behalf | Principal minus prepaid finance charges |
| Total of Payments — The amount you will have paid after making all scheduled payments | Amount Financed + Finance Charge |
| Payment Schedule — Your payment schedule will be | Uniform: count × amount × frequency. Irregular/balloon: full date-and-amount table |
Math check: Amount Financed + Finance Charge must equal Total of Payments. Recalculate APR if any fee or term changes.
